Spring Card from Floral Delight

Today’s project is a Spring Card from the Floral Delight Designer Paper.  This week on Teach it Tuesday with Tammy and Jennie I created a Spring Card using the Floral Delight 12×12 Designer Paper.  Pairing it with the Storybook Life Photopolymer Stamp Set this adds the finishing touched for the Springtime Theme we are showcasing this week.

 

 

 

PROJECT VIDEO:  If you are receiving this in email, please catch the Video HERE

 

 

 

 

Project Dimensions:
  • Card base in Pool Party 55 1/2″ x 8 1/2″ scored at 4 1/4″
  • 2 Basic White Panels 4″ x 5 1/4″
  • DSP Strips: (1) 2″ x 3 3/4″ (1) 1 1/4″ x 3 3/4″ (1) 7/8″ x 3 3/4″ (1) 5/8″ x 3 3/4″
  • 1/2″ x 5 1/4″ inside Strip
  • 2 1/2″ x 6″ DSP Strip to decorate envelope
  • Largest Nested Essential rounded square in Basic White
  • Finish up with Brushed Brass Butterflies and Balmy Blue Bakers Twine

Meant To Bee Alternate Project

This week on Teach it Tuesday with Tammy and Jennie, I am creating a Meant To Bee Alternate Project using the remaining supplies from the Meant To Bee Scrapbooking Kit.  This Meant To Bee Alternate Project was so fun to create.

 

This Meant To Bee Alternate Project is a great way to use up the Meant To Bee Scrapbooking Kit supplies that you don't use scrapbooking

 

 

This accordion gift card holder is a fun way to use up your extra pieces from the Meant To Bee Scrapbooking Kit.

 

I love a good gift card holder, and this unique accordion fold is a great way to use you those extra designer paper panels.

 

PROJECT VIDEO:  If you are receiving this in email, please catch the Video HERE

 

 

 

Project Dimensions:
  • (2) 1/4″ panel sheets in Petunia Pop 4 1/4″ x 5 1/2″
  • Inside Accordion Piece in Pretty in Pink 4 1/4″ x 11″ scored at 2 3/4″, 5 1/2″ Flip and score at 2 3/4″ on the other side
  • (3) Basic White Panel Pieces 2 1/2″ x 4″
  • (3) DSP Panels 4″ x 5 1/4″
  • Little Strip for inside 3/4″ x 2 1/2″
